Product Listings Information

  • You must give an accurate and honest description of all products on display on your product catalog. If the items are brand new or second-hand, you must state so in the product description.
  • We operate a view-before-payment policy. What this means is that the user pays only upon delivery and inspection of the goods. The customer reserves the right to reject the product upon inspection after shipment made should they detect any discrepancies between the advertised catalog product and the delivered product.
  • The products on show within the Business Field Malaysia product catalogs do not belong to us, and we take no responsibility for them. We affiliated with the businesses that promote and sell these products so negative consumer feedback or complaints of customer dissatisfaction regarding any products or merchants will result in penalizing measures which could ultimately end in affiliate termination.

Business Listings Information

  • By becoming the official Author of a Business Listing, you are certifying that you are an official representative of this business, brand, organization or person and that you’re authorized to edit and modify the Business Listing for that subject. You agree to take full responsibility for any repercussions that may follow.
  • Business Field Malaysia takes no responsibility for modifications made to a Business Listing. All responsibility clashes will be handled offline, for example, in the case of an imposter taking responsibility for a listing that they’re not affiliated with and all subsequent actions.
  • Deleting a Business Listing is a right reserved solely by our team, and such a request will only be honored for legal reasons.
  • Business Field Malaysia reserves the right to disassociate any Author from any Business Listing at any time at our discretion, which would usually be the end-result of scenarios such as a lack of activity on the Business Listing, no communication from the author after several attempts, etc.
  • As the Author of the Business Listing, you are to ensure that you keep your business listings information up to date. You can modify your business listings information at any time from the browser window.

Intellectual property abuse

We do not allow content that:

  • infringes copyright. It is our policy to respond to notices of alleged infringement that comply with the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ission Act (MCMC).
  • sells or promotes the sale of counterfeit products. Counterfeit goods contain a trademark or logo that is identical to or substantially indistinguishable from the trademark of another. They mimic the brand features of the product in an attempt to pass themselves off as a genuine product of the brand owner.

Dangerous or derogatory content

We do not allow content that:

  • Incites hatred against, promotes discrimination of, or disparages an individual or group on the basis of their race or ethnic origin, religion, disability, age, nationality, veteran status, sexual orientation, gender, gender identity, or other characteristic that is associated with systemic discrimination or marginalization. Examples: Promoting hate groups or hate group paraphernalia, encouraging others to believe that a person or group is inhuman, inferior, or worthy of being hated.
  • Harasses, intimidates, or bullies an individual or group of individuals. Examples: Singling out someone for abuse or harassment, suggesting a tragic event did not happen or that victims or their families are actors or complicit in a cover-up of the event.
  • Threatens or advocates for harm to oneself or others. Examples: Content advocating suicide, anorexia, or other self-harm; promoting or advocating for harmful health or medical claims or practices; threatening someone with real-life harm or calling for the attack of another person; promoting, glorifying, or condoning violence against others; content made by or in support of terrorist groups, or content that promotes terrorist acts, including recruitment, or that celebrates terrorist attacks.
  • Exploits others through extortion. Examples: Predatory removals, revenge porn, blackmail.

Enabling dishonest behavior

We do not allow content that:

  • Helps users to mislead others. Examples: Creating fake or false documents such as passports, diplomas, or accreditation; sale or distribution of term papers, paper-writing or exam-taking services; information or products for passing drug tests.
  • Promotes any form of hacking or cracking and/or provides users with instructions or equipment that tampers with or provides unauthorized access to software, servers, or websites. Examples: Pages or products that enable illegal access of cell phones and other communications or content delivery systems or devices; products or services that bypass copyright protection, including circumvention of digital rights management technologies; products that illegally descramble cable or satellite signals in order to get free services; pages that assist or enable users to download streaming videos if prohibited by the content provider.
